uniapp获取当前页面url

2021-02-24  本文已影响0人  GiRaffe_
export function getUrl() {
      var pages = getCurrentPages() //获取加载的页面
      var currentPage = pages[pages.length - 1] //获取当前页面的对象
      var url = currentPage.route //当前页面url
      uni.setStorage({  
        key: 'currentUrl',
        data: `/${url}`
      })
      //var options = currentPage.options //如果要获取url中所带的参数可以查看options   
      //参数多时通过&拼接url的参数
      // var urlWithArgs = url + '?'
      // for (var key in options) {
      //   var value = options[key]
      //   urlWithArgs += key + '=' + value + '&'
      // }
      // urlWithArgs = urlWithArgs.substring(0, urlWithArgs.length - 1)
      // uni.setStorage({  
      //    key: 'url',
      //    data: `/${urlWithArgs}`
      // })
}
上一篇 下一篇

猜你喜欢

热点阅读